HOUSTON, July 25 — HPE (NYSE: HPE) today announced the appointment of David Goulden to its Board of Directors, effective today. Goulden joins the Board’s Finance & Investment Committee and HR & Compensation Committee.
Goulden brings more than 35 years of experience, including extensive management and financial leadership at global technology companies. Most recently, he served as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er of Booking Holdings Inc., the global online travel company and parent of brands including Booking.com, Priceline, and KAYAK.

Goulden previously spent more than a decade in senior leadership roles at EMC Corporation, an enterprise technology company acquired by Dell Technologies in 2016, where he served as Chief Financial Officer, Chief Operating Officer, and Chief Executive Officer of EMC’s Information Infrastructure business. He helped manage integration efforts after the EMC transaction, which at the time was the largest technology merger in history.
Goulden then served as President of the combined company’s Infrastructure Solutions Group, which included its storage, server, and networking businesses, until he joined Booking Holdings.

Goulden previously served on the board of VMware, where he was a member of the Audit and Mergers & Acquisitions Committees.
